How far is Milton, Ontario, Canada from Niagara-on-the-Lake?

The distance from Milton, Ontario, Canada to Niagara-on-the-Lake is 44.6 miles (71.7 km) as the crow flies. Niagara-on-the-Lake is located ESE of Milton, Ontario, Canada. By car, the driving distance is approximately 60.6 miles, taking about 1h 24min. A direct flight would take roughly 35min. Both are located in Canada.
